Reese made his presence felt on both ends with a steady, high-IQ performance against Mike Glennon Elite . He attacked drives with the willingness to take on contact and stayed active off- ball, working screens and never standing still within the offense.

Defensively, he showed good vision and communication, talking through actions while maintaining solid lateral slide to stay in front. He also created disruption, including forcing a jump ball with active defensive positioning. On the glass, Reese extended possessions with offensive rebounds and second-effort plays. Offensively, he can also operate as a post-up option at times, adding versatility to his game.

On a Breakaway Gold Team filled with talent, Reese stands out as a seamless fit who impacts winning on both ends.

An athletic, high-motor combo guard from Chicago West Suburbs who’s quickly becoming a key piece for Glenbard South. A true do-it-all presence, Reese consistently finds ways to impact the game—always around the ball and rarely taking a play off.

Offensively, he does most of his damage inside the paint, using his quickness and strength to finish through traffic. He’s also capable of knocking down the three when left open, keeping defenders honest. Reese’s energy stands out, especially on the boards, where he contributes significantly as a guard and generates valuable second-chance opportunities.

Defensively, he flies around the court, showing his ability to disrupt plays, contest shots, and rotate effectively. While his shot selection and decision-making are still developing, he’s showing clear signs of rounding into a well-rounded, two-way contributor with a bright future.

Sean Reese proved to be a competitive defender who locks up in both halfcourt and full-court situations. Reese played with a knack for creating havoc on the court Whether it’s stripping the ball from dribblers, jumping into passing lanes for steals, or deflecting passes and dribbles, he forced countless turnovers and disrupted the rhythm of the opposing offense play after play. One of his biggest standout qualities as a defender was his ability to contest every shot, even attempts that seem out of his range, displaying the awareness and quick reaction to close out on shooters rapidly, often making up ground with his speed and length.

Reese undoubtedly stood out as one of the top prospects in the 2027 class during the Spring Exposure Session. As a shooting guard from Glenbard South, he showed the ability to generate his own scoring opportunities at any moment. Whether driving with finesse to secure position inside the key, executing mid-range pull-ups, or confidently setting up along the perimeter, Reese showcased an impressive three-level scoring repertoire.

He actively engaged his teammates by delivering sharp passes, demonstrating not just his scoring but also his playmaking ability. Reese showed some skill on the boards too, consistently grabbing rebounds within his reach and hustling to secure loose balls. Reese is undoubtedly a young athlete poised for growth and success in the years to come.
